LA is a big place - any general geographic location?

I got mine done at pure touch laser center on woodman avenue in studio city. I found them via a groupon coupon and they were pretty cheap and they use a very good laser. I had about 12 sessions and now only a few straggling black hairs have popped back up after my last session 6 months ago. A couple of touch up sessions ought to take care of them. I went in guy mode for the first few sessions and finished in girl mode and no one ever said anything.

It depends on how well you shop - LA is a big place and you can easily spend big or you can search out the deals; with the number of businesses here good deals can be found pretty easily.

I got 6 sessions of laser for $120 on my Groupon. 6 more sessions @ $200 cleared my face and neck of everything but the white/gray ones and a few stragglers; a couple of touch up sessions will take care of the stragglers.
